Web9 apr. 2024 · A mature bull elk can run up to 40 miles per hour and is capable of an eight foot vertical jump. Researchers found that an elk’s ankle bones make a distinct popping or cracking noise when they walk. They surmise the sound may help alert other elk that they are being approached from behind. Web13 okt. 2024 · Most of the deer farmers I know construct fences at least 8 feet or higher. Few, if any deer, can jump that high for Alcatraz freedom, but most can clear a 6-foot fence without batting a Bambi eyelash.
